当TP钱包拒绝授权:一场支付层的技术审判

在一次TP钱包授权失败的深度评测中,本文从产品与技术并行的角度剖析原因与修复路径

。作为创新支付平台的前端交互枢纽,TP钱包既承担高效支付技术的落地,也要兼顾分布式应用(dApp)与合约调用的复杂性。授权失败通常并非单点故障,需按流程拆解排查:重现问题→采集日志(RPC响应、交易nonce、gas估算)→隔离链上合约调用(本地私链或测试网)→校验签名与chainId→检查钱包与dApp握手协议(权限scope与回调)→确认安全芯片/TEE是否拒绝私钥签署。专家角度提示,常见根因包括节点不同步、合约ABI变更、权限请求过宽导致用户拒绝、以及安全芯片固件与应用层兼容问题。针对隐私与安全,评测强调交易隐私不应牺牲可审计性:建议采用最小权限授权、链上事件过滤而非暴露全部交易元数据、并在客户端实现交易模糊化与提交前本地审计。产品层面建议增加多级回滚与用户友好提示、授权预演(dry-r

un)与计费估算、高级日志打点以便快速定位;技术层面建议在合约调用链中加入签名前校验、在硬件安全模块上实现备份签名策略。最终,本次评测认为:TP钱包授权失败往往是多方协同不足的体现,通过标准化排障流程、明确权限模型与强化安全芯片兼容测试,可以在保证交易隐私的前提下显著提升授权成功率与用户信任。

作者:李知远发布时间:2026-01-21 09:49:21

评论

相关阅读
<small dropzone="ikr"></small>